Young Africans for Peace and Development (YAPAD) is a non-profit organization established in 2019, dedicated to promoting peace, development, and human rights across Kenya, Ethiopia, and Somalia. Founded by a group of young individuals, YAPAD operates in several cities within these countries, striving to unite people from diverse backgrounds and provide accurate information to vulnerable communities affected by conflict and insecurity.

Our Mission

To build resilient and cohesive communities in the Horn of Africa by supporting youth and women-led initiatives that drive socio-economic transformation and sustainable development.

Our Vision

To promote harmonious and inclusive communities where youth, women, and marginalized groups are the champions of peace, development, and environmental stewardship.
